UniProt Protein Function: | TRIP8: Probable histone demethylase that specifically demethylates 'Lys-9' of histone H3, thereby playing a central role in histone code. Demethylation of Lys residue generates formaldehyde and succinate. May be involved in hormone-dependent transcriptional activation, by participating in recruitment to androgen-receptor target genes. Belongs to the JHDM2 histone demethylase family. 3 isoforms of the human protein are produced by alternative splicing.Protein type: EC 1.14.11.-; Demethylase; Oxidoreductase; Nuclear receptor co-regulator; Transcription, coactivator/corepressorChromosomal Location of Human Ortholog: 10q21.3Cellular Component: nucleoplasmMolecular Function: histone demethylase activity (H3-K9 specific); protein binding; thyroid hormone receptor bindingBiological Process: blood coagulation; regulation of transcription, DNA-dependent |

NCBI Summary: | The protein encoded by this gene interacts with thyroid hormone receptors and contains a jumonji domain. It is a candidate histone demethylase and is thought to be a coactivator for key transcription factors. It plays a role in the DNA-damage response pathway by demethylating the mediator of DNA damage checkpoint 1 (MDC1) protein, and is required for the survival of acute myeloid leukemia. Mutations in this gene are associated with Rett syndrome and intellectual disability.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2015] |
